Google Previews Pixel 11 Pro in New Promotional Video

Google has released a teaser video for its upcoming Pixel 11 Pro, aiming to generate excitement around the newest addition to its smartphone lineup. The video hints at various features and improvements that users can anticipate. As part of a broader release strategy, the Pixel 11 Pro is expected to include enhancements in camera quality, battery life, and overall performance.

The Pixel 11 series, which includes the Pixel 11, Pixel 11 Pro, Pixel 11 Pro XL, and Pixel 11 Pro Fold, is expected to officially launch in the near future. According to sources close to the matter, the devices will emphasize improved photographic capabilities, including a 10.8 MP telephoto camera, plus additional features that have yet to be confirmed.

In addition to performance upgrades, reports indicate that the Pixel 11 HiLight will support a variety of color options, details of which have been revealed through Google Contacts. This aligns with Googles strategy to offer users more customizable choices.

While the full specifications have yet to be officially disclosed, early leaks suggest that the devices may not feature an RGB notification LED—a departure from previous models.
